This is a bonus episode of the BobbyCast. A show that Bobby does from his house! 

Songwriter Tom Douglas stops by the BobbyCast. He tells the story behind writing "The House That Built Me", multiple songs for Tim McGraw and his theories on how to approach writing a song.
